HC Deb 27 April 1983 vol 41 cc336-7W
Mr. Nicholas Winterton

asked the Minister for Trade by how much it is estimated imports in 1983 of textiles and clothing will differ from imports in 1982.

Mr. Peter Rees

No precise estimate of textiles and clothing imports in 1983 can be made, since this will depend on a number of variables such as fashion trends, the level of domestic demand and the ability of British manufacturers to meet market requirements.

Mr. Nicholas Winterton

asked the Minister for Trade by how much imports of textiles and clothing from non-multi-fibre arrangement countries rose in 1982.

Mr. Peter Rees

The overall increase in the value of textile and clothing imports in 1982 was £227.403 million (to a total of £2,520.673 million), of which £157.524 million represented the increase in the textile sector (to a total of £1,693.395 million) and £69.879 million the increase in the clothing sector (to £827.278 million).
